“Single Life,” “Word up,” and “Candy,” have any idea what group created these hits?? You’re right, Cameo, the funk-infused R&B group formed in the 70s.

Cameo, created in 1974, by former Julliard student and New York area clubgoer, Larry Blackmon, started out with 23 members and was called the New York Players. After concerns that people would get the group mixed up with the popular group the Ohio Players, in 1976, they renamed the group to Cameo. They released several albums between 1977-2000 on various labels including Chocolate City, Atlanta Artists, Mercury, and Reprise. In addition, Cameo released 16 compilation albums between 1992-2006.
